Can you help me convert a field value extracted by a rex command to another date time format?

I have certain field values extracted by using rex command. The timestamp format of the field value is in ISO 8601.
For example -

lgk":"2018-09-24T04:41:54Z"

I need to convert it in the following format

%m-%d-%Y %H:%M:%S %p

I tried using strftime but that doesn't work. Gives blank results. Can somebody please help me with some pointers?

Try this run anywhere search:

|makeresults|eval t="2018-09-24T04:41:54Z"|eval b=strftime(strptime(t,"%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%SZ"),"%m-%d-%Y %H:%M:%S %p")
